Denise Welch Reflects on Helicopter Parenting and Supporting Loose Women Campaign

Denise Welch, known for her role on ITV's Loose Women, recently discussed her parenting style, describing herself as a 'helicopter mum' to her famous sons, Matty Healy of The 1975 and actor Louis Healy. She also shared her experience with domestic abuse, highlighting the importance of the 'Facing It Together' campaign.

Key Insights

Denise Welch admits to being a "helicopter parent," constantly hovering over her adult sons' lives.

She reflects on her past parenting style, contrasting her earlier laid-back approach with her current attentiveness.

Welch attributes this change to a need for reassurance of her importance in her sons' lives.

Her sons, Matty and Louis Healy, have successful careers in music and acting, respectively.

On a special Loose Women episode, Welch discussed a past abusive relationship, emphasizing the subtle beginnings of such situations and the importance of recognizing warning signs.

She highlighted how abusers can chip away at personality, isolating individuals and making them overly dependent.
